Who is Cassandra Nova?

As described by Marvel.com, Cassandra Nova is a member of a species of bodiless parasites composed of living emotional energy known as the "Mummudrai" and they appear to every being in utero shortly before birth as their ultimate opposite.

In this case, she is the twin sister of Charles Xavier as she copies his DNA and creates her own body. However, Charles senses her monstrous thoughts and attempts to kill her which results in her stillborn-looking body.

They are also telepathically entangled and, as a result, Cassandra also has psionic powers. However, the difference is she has a dark ideology and is bent on destruction and genocide.

The most well-known act that Cassandra has done in the comics is leading an army of Sentinels to massacre millions of mutants in Genosha.

Who is Playing Cassandra Nova in Deadpool and Wolverine?

In Deadpool and Wolverine, Cassandra Nova is going to be played by Emmy-nominated actor Emma Corrin (The Crown).

The details regarding the character's role in the film remain under wraps, but we can safely say that she has psionic powers like in the source material as we've seen in the few glimpses of her in the trailer.

There is no doubt that Cassandra is an interesting choice for the villain of the film and it would be curious to see whether she will also be portrayed as someone who has genocidal tendencies and is related to Charles Xavier.

Deadpool and Wolverine is scheduled to arrive in theaters this July 26.
